Description

Douw G. Steyn and S T Rao delve into the complex world of air pollution through a comprehensive exploration of modeling techniques and their applications. This work addresses both local and urban scale modeling, offering insights into how pollutants disperse and affect various environments. The authors guide readers through the intricacies of regional modeling, emphasizing its importance for understanding broader environmental impacts.

Throughout the book, contributors engage with diverse case studies, demonstrating practical applications of modeling strategies in real-world scenarios. The collaborative efforts of various participants enrich the content, showcasing the collective expertise in tackling air quality issues.

By bridging theoretical foundations with practical insights, this volume serves as an essential resource for researchers, policymakers, and environmental practitioners dedicated to tackling the growing challenges posed by air pollution. The rigorous approach to modeling and the emphasis on effective solutions underscore a commitment to advancing air quality management strategies.
